Motorists on the South Luzon Expressway (SLEX) and Southern Tagalog Arterial Road (STAR) Tollway will face higher toll rates starting January 1, 2026, the Toll Regulatory Board (TRB) announced.
The increases apply to Class 1, 2, and 3 vehicles across key sections of both expressways.
On SLEX, tolls from Alabang to Calamba will rise by P10 to P31 depending on vehicle class, while Calamba to Sto. Tomas will see smaller hikes.
STAR Tollway users will also pay more, with Sto. Tomas to Lipa and Lipa to Batangas sections are seeing increases of P4 to P14 per vehicle class.
The TRB said the adjustment aims to support ongoing operations, maintenance, and improvements for safer and more convenient travel.
